Taiyuan Schools Questionable at Best
Taiyuan Teachers' College
- this is where I'm at now
- OK for a one-year stint and they'll usually provide a reference letter
- the dean of the English Department has no tact and expects everybody to obey his orders, hence his general dislike for questioning foreigners
- getting materials and the like can be problematic (at best)
- apartment bathrooms stink like a Chinese public WC (no joke)
- students are great and you'll teach oral, literature, or writing
- contracts often go without a chop, even after hounding
- any contract amendments are verbal or they don't happen at all
- the main heating is nowhere near hot enough to keep the apartment warm, even with 2 electric heaters
- furniture in disrepair, also the bedsheets are too small for the bed
- phone bills are never paid for, so get a cell
- anything after the contract is signed won't be done unless it's a light bulb or something similar
- water is a pain to order without a Chinese friend with know-how
- you are informed of changes and events no earlier than 3 hours beforehand
- it's in downtown Taiyuan where everything is within a 12-minute bikeride
- water is shut off at 11pm and comes back on around 6am
- the campus internet is shut off at around 10:20pm and is back on around 7:50am
